Image Processing and IoT Based Innovative Energy Conservation Technique
This paper illustrates an innovative, real-time, energy monitoring system in educational institutions, using MATLAB, image acquisition and processing mechanism. Smart Innovative Method for Energy (E-SIM) conservation proposed here, designs, deploys and evaluates energy consumption patterns of laboratories, lecture theaters and halls in institutions. Specially designed hardware is used to monitor energy consumption pattern of each laboratory or lecture hall. The data is then matched with the time-table and occupancy level of that laboratory or lecture hall using cloud based data analytics and IoT (Internet of Things) in real time. If the energy consumption doesn’t match the time-table or the occupancy level, an alert is generated for further investigation and action. Matching energy consumption patterns with the time-table of laboratories and lecture halls in an educational institution over a period of time can result in significant energy saving. The E-SIM may help institutes design cost-effective recommendations to address energy inefficiencies and implement new initiatives. The complete design includes energy infrastructure (metered laboratories and lecture theaters), energy routing within institutes, web applications and data analytics. The E-SIM helps monitor the utilization of energy in organizations resulting in efficient energy management by them thereby reducing their environmental impact. By monitoring plug loads in each laboratory or lecture theatre, the number of devices using energy, the number of occupants and the actual energy use can be better managed. This is the vital information required to take actions and policy decisions for saving energy and it may, in future, provide the real time on-line digital ability to on-off control at each plug.
